Understanding Water Softener Systems
Water softener systems perform a crucial role in households by minimizing the hardness of water. Water hardness is attributed to the presence of minerals like calcium and magnesium. These elements can result in a range of issues, such as scaling on fixtures, rough skin and hair, and diminished performance of detergents.
A water softener system incorporates a process called ion exchange to remove these hardness-causing minerals. Inside the system, beads is charged with sodium ions. As hard water passes through the resin, the calcium and magnesium ions are trapped by the resin, replacing the sodium ions.
This process results in softened water that is smoother on your skin, hair, and appliances. In addition to enhancing the quality of your water, a water softener can also increase the lifespan of your plumbing.
Below are some of the benefits of using a water softener system:
* Reduced scale buildup
* Softer skin and hair
* Improved detergent effectiveness
* Increased lifespan of appliances and plumbing

Selecting the Right Water Softening System for Your Needs
Finding the perfect water softening system for your home can feel like navigating a labyrinth of choices. A plethora factors influence which system is right for you, like your household size, water hardness level, and budget. First and foremost, determine your the water's hardness level. You can obtain this data through a simple home test kit or by contacting your local water provider.
Once you know your water hardness level, you can begin to investigate different types of softening systems. Conventional salt-based systems are commonly used and effective at removing minerals from water. However, those require regular salt. Eco-friendly alternatives like potassium-based softeners or magnetic water conditioners offer a more sustainable option, although their effectiveness may vary.
Consider your budget and installation costs when making your decision. Some systems are more pricey upfront but may require less maintenance over time. Ultimately, the best water softening system top water softener for you is the one that fulfills your individual needs and preferences.
Water Softener System Installation and Care
A brand-new water softener can greatly improve your home's water quality. However, proper installation and consistent maintenance are vital for ensuring optimal performance and longevity. Before you begin, meticulously peruse the manufacturer's instructions provided with your specific model.
Installation typically entails connecting the softener and your home's water supply line, creating an outflow pathway, and placing the softener in a suitable area. Maintenance requires frequent examination of salt levels, flushing the system to remove accumulated debris, and occasionally replacing filters and other replaceable elements.
- Obey the manufacturer's recommendations for salt level refills and system flushing.
- Arrange professional maintenance check-ups as recommended.
- Monitor water pressure and flow rate for any significant changes.
By following these guidelines, you can ensure that your water softener operates effectively and providesyou with clean, soft water for years to come.
